Output 7e8a96a4f1069a681638d226cc4224de26cc19d14428d6ea30efcf30f52e959e:2

value
38441586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d878d122974e6d01fbdb041f80bd53697fd4377 OP_EQUAL
address
MLoVtjM6B7EYuwL3zTaFmKKdAxxKUNUiY5
transaction
7e8a96a4f1069a681638d226cc4224de26cc19d14428d6ea30efcf30f52e959e
spent
true